Responsibilities

As a Small Tools Engineer, your key responsibilities will include:

  • Inspecting and maintaining small tools to ensure they are safe and operational.
  • Collaborating with site teams to address tool-related needs and issues.
  • Keeping detailed records of inspections, repairs, and tool usage.
  • Ensuring all work areas are clean, organized, and compliant with safety standards.
  • Participating in training sessions to stay updated on industry standards and best practices.

Qualifications

To excel in this role as a Small Tools Engineer, you should possess the following qualifications and skills:

  • Strong commitment to health and safety practices.
  • Ability to follow and understand manufacturers' maintenance schedules.
  • Proficiency in PAT testing and completing tagging processes.
  • Experience in servicing and repairing small tools.
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to work independently or as part of a team.
  • Flexibility to work additional hours and respond to out-of-hours calls.
